This is the most suitable <u><a href=\"https:\/\/www.bilogistik.com\/en\/logistics-services\/multimodal-transport\/\">sea transport<\/a><\/u> system for solid bulk freight, liquid bulk and mass industrial products. 3 major contracts stand out within this process, the particular features of which are detailed below.<\/p>\n<h2>Bareboat charter<\/h2>\n<p>This is a <strong>lease contract with a determined term,<\/strong> where the <strong>leaseholder has full control of the vessel<\/strong>, including the right to designate captain and crew. It is used whenever one wishes to operate a ship.<\/p>\n<p><strong>The lessor<\/strong> or owner of the vessel is solely entitled to <strong>receive a regular payment<\/strong> for rental of the same. They have no<strong> liability in relation to the freight <\/strong>or transactions of the vessel during the contract term.<\/p>\n<p>The <strong>Barecon \/89<\/strong> form contains the <strong>leaseholder\u2019s obligations to properly use the vessel <\/strong>and return it on time and in good condition. The leaseholder shall also be liable for any claims arising from the operation of the vessel and shall be unable <strong>to sublet without the express permission <\/strong>of the lessor.<\/p>\n<h2>Voyage charter<\/h2>\n<p>A particular feature of this contract is that <strong>the charteree provides the charterer with the vessel\u2019s cargo space during a specific trip.<\/strong> The shipowner undertakes to transport these goods and assumes responsibility for the management of the vessel. <strong>The charteree can deliver its own cargo or outsource the space to third parties<\/strong>. It is a very commonly used charter to transport goods in bulk.<\/p>\n<p>Contained in this contract is the <strong>bill of lading<\/strong>, a receipt certifying <strong>the placement of the cargo<\/strong>, as well as all the features of the same in writing, such as name and registration of the vessel, origin and destination, type of goods and the value of the freight<\/p>\n<p>The conditions of these contracts are often negotiated with the <strong>intermediation of freight brokers<\/strong>. However, the <strong>charteree\u2019s duties <\/strong>include possession of a <strong>vessel suitable for the cargo <\/strong>to be transported, the selection of the most appropriate route and the <strong>guarantee of delivery of the cargo<\/strong> at the end of the trip. The <strong>charterer<\/strong> undertakes to <strong>load only what was agreed<\/strong>.<\/p>\n<h2>Time charter<\/h2>\n<p>This is an interesting format for importers and exporters who require rapid transport. Its particular feature is how <strong>charteree provides the charterer with a vessel for a specified period<\/strong> of time. <strong>The charteree retains the nautical management <\/strong>of the vessel, while <strong>the charterer is responsible for the commercial management.<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>The <strong>charteree\u2019s duties include<\/strong> the newly introduced duty for this party to ensure that <strong>captain and crew comply with the charterer\u2019s trade orders<\/strong>.
